R

Rahul Mourya

Senior Software Engineer

Bengaluru, Karnataka, India15 yrs 8 mos experience
Most Likely To SwitchHighly Stable

Key Highlights

  • Expert in designing scalable distributed systems.
  • Proficient in microservices architecture and cloud integration.
  • Strong background in Java technologies and performance optimization.
Stackforce AI infers this person is a Backend-heavy Fullstack Engineer in the Supply Chain and Cloud Integration sectors.

Contact

Skills

Core Skills

MicroservicesSpring BootCloud TechnologiesBpm TechnologiesJava

Other Skills

KafkaIBM MQSQLNoSQLDockerKuberneteswebMethods Integration CloudOperations ManagementJVM InternalsGarbage Collection PoliciesData StructuresAlgorithmsCore JavaJ2EEEnterprise JavaBeans (EJB)

About

Experienced Senior Software Engineer with a demonstrated history of working with highly scalable distributed systems. With profound experience in working with Spring Boot, Kafka, IBM MQ and persistence layers with SQL/NoSQL technologies. Strong engineering professional with a Bachelor of Technology (B.Tech.) focused in Computer Engineering from Indian Institute of Technology (Banaras Hindu University), Varanasi.

Experience

15 yrs 8 mos
Total Experience
5 yrs 2 mos
Average Tenure
6 yrs 9 mos
Current Experience

Walmart global tech india

Senior Software Engineer

Aug 2019Present · 6 yrs 9 mos · Bengaluru, Karnataka, India

  • Currently working under the supply chain domain on a Nxt-Gen cloud native solution (Yard Management System), which manages the day-to-day business operations in a Distribution Center. Worked on designing and development of multiple microservices and an integration framework for managing the flow lifecycle. Also, integrated the legacy system with the cloud native platform to optimize the cost and current business flows and to provide a unified enhanced user experience.
Spring BootMicroservicesKafkaIBM MQSQLNoSQL+2

Software ag

3 roles

Engineering Specialist

Apr 2018Jul 2019 · 1 yr 3 mos

  • Worked on Cloud Technologies, webMethods Integration Cloud which is an integration Platform-as-a-Service (iPaaS) that provides all the tools you need to seamlessly integrate applications hosted in public and private clouds with the ability to connect applications hosted on premises.
Cloud TechnologieswebMethods Integration Cloud

Engineering Specialist

Jun 2016Apr 2018 · 1 yr 10 mos

  • Worked on BPM Technologies, server side development of the runtime engines responsible for handling the operations management lifecycle which includes various methods to discover, model, analyze, measure, improve, optimize, and automate business processes.
BPM TechnologiesOperations Management

Senior Software Engineer

Jan 2015Jun 2016 · 1 yr 5 mos

  • Worked on BPM Technologies, server side development of the runtime engines responsible for handling the operations management lifecycle which includes various methods to discover, model, analyze, measure, improve, optimize, and automate business processes.
BPM TechnologiesOperations Management

Ibm

Software Engineer

Jul 2010Dec 2014 · 4 yrs 5 mos · Bengaluru Area, India

  • IBM JDK, Java Technology Center (JTC)
  • Worked in Java Technologies Center, development of JVM runtime and class libraries for IBM JDK. Worked on JVM Internals, Garbage Collection Policies and System Resource Utilizations for JVM.
  • Worked with internal and external customers to understand business requirements and facilitate cooperation for continuous quality, scalability, and performance improvement of IBM JDK through issues/bugs reported on Java 1.4.2, Java 5 and Java 6 on multiple platforms.
JavaJVM InternalsGarbage Collection Policies

Education

Indian Institute of Technology (Banaras Hindu University), Varanasi

Bachelor of Technology (B.Tech.) — Computer Engineering

Jan 2006Jan 2010

Stackforce found 100+ more professionals with Microservices & Spring Boot

Explore similar profiles based on matching skills and experience